Chile: The Anchor Market That's Already Proven Itself
Chile didn't become South America's most mature data center market by accident. It earned that position through a combination of political stability, reliable grid infrastructure, and — critically — one of the region's most robust submarine cable ecosystems. The country serves as a landing point for multiple transoceanic cables connecting South America to North America, Asia, and Europe, making it a natural hub for latency-sensitive workloads.
Santiago has effectively become the Frankfurt of South America — a tier-one colocation market where hyperscalers anchor large deployments and enterprise demand fills in around them. Google has operated a cloud region in Chile since 2021, a signal that carries real weight when institutional capital is evaluating where to place long-term data center bets. Microsoft and AWS have both signaled ongoing regional commitments as well.
The numbers reinforce the narrative. Chile's data center market has been tracking double-digit annual growth, with total installed capacity in Santiago alone exceeding several hundred megawatts across colocation and hyperscale facilities. For context, that's comparable to secondary U.S. markets like Phoenix or Atlanta just five to seven years ago — markets that have since exploded in value.
What investors sometimes overlook about Chile is the renewable energy angle. The Atacama Desert gives Chile one of the world's highest solar irradiance levels, and the country's grid mix has been rapidly decarbonizing. For data center operators facing ESG pressure from enterprise clients and institutional backers alike, that's not a minor footnote — it's a competitive advantage that can differentiate a Chilean campus from peers in fossil-fuel-dependent markets.
Challenges exist. Santiago's land constraints are real, and power interconnection timelines can frustrate development schedules. But compared to peers in the region, Chile's permitting environment and grid reliability remain best-in-class.
Peru and Colombia: Where the Growth Curve Gets Interesting
If Chile is the established play, Peru and Colombia represent the emerging markets thesis — higher risk, higher runway, and a fundamentally different investment profile.
Colombia's Case: Bogotá and Beyond
Colombia's data center market has been quietly maturing for years, anchored by Bogotá's role as a financial and commercial hub for the northern Andes. The country has attracted meaningful colocation investment, and its relatively young, tech-savvy population is driving cloud adoption at rates that outpace infrastructure availability. That supply-demand imbalance is exactly the kind of structural condition that produces strong returns for early data center investors.
AWS launched a cloud region in Colombia — a development that functions as a market validation signal investors should not underestimate. When a hyperscaler commits to regional infrastructure, it doesn't just serve existing demand; it catalyzes new enterprise cloud migration that creates additional colocation and edge demand downstream. The ripple effect is predictable and, for infrastructure owners positioned ahead of it, quite profitable.
Colombia's connectivity profile is improving steadily. Expanded submarine cable access and growing fiber penetration across its major cities are reducing the latency disadvantages that once made international operators hesitant. The regulatory environment, while more complex than Chile's, has become more data center-friendly as the government recognizes the sector's economic multiplier effects.
Peru: Under the Radar, Not for Long
Peru is the least developed of the three markets discussed here, but dismissing it would be a mistake. Lima is home to roughly 11 million people and serves as the commercial gateway for one of South America's fastest-growing economies. Cloud services demand from Peru's banking sector, government digitization initiatives, and a growing startup ecosystem is creating the early-stage demand signal that precedes serious data center expansion.
The infrastructure deficit in Peru is substantial — which cuts both ways. It creates friction for operators who need reliable power and connectivity today, but it also means the competitive landscape remains uncrowded. Investors who can tolerate development-stage risk in Peru are likely to face far less competition than they would entering Santiago's market at this point.
Submarine cable investment targeting Peru is also increasing, which will materially improve the country's connectivity fundamentals over the next three to five years. That's the kind of infrastructure precondition that transforms a speculative market into a bankable one.
What Smart Capital Looks for When Evaluating New Markets
Data center investment in emerging markets rewards disciplined underwriting. The investors who get burned are typically those who mistake GDP growth or internet penetration statistics for project-level bankability. The ones who succeed evaluate a tighter set of criteria.
Power availability and grid stability top the list. A data center without reliable power isn't a data center — it's an expensive shell. Backup generation can compensate for grid variability, but at significant capital and operating cost. Markets where grid infrastructure is being actively upgraded (Chile, Colombia's urban centers) are materially different from those where reliability remains genuinely uncertain.
Connectivity depth matters more than most real estate-focused investors realize. A facility's value is directly tied to how many network paths reach it and how much latency those paths introduce. Submarine cable landing points, internet exchange presence, and carrier-neutral interconnection options all feed into this calculus.
Land tenure and permitting predictability deserve serious diligence. In several Latin American markets, land title complexity and permitting timelines can add 12 to 24 months to development schedules — a meaningful drag on returns in an environment where cloud services demand isn't waiting.
Finally, watch the hyperscaler signals. When AWS, Google, or Microsoft announces a regional cloud region, they're effectively publishing a demand forecast. Local colocation and edge operators positioned near those anchor deployments consistently outperform those who built speculatively without that anchor tenant validation.
The Trends That Will Define the Next Five Years
Several dynamics are worth tracking closely across all three markets. Artificial intelligence workloads are reshaping power density requirements — facilities designed to 5-8 kW per rack are increasingly inadequate for GPU-intensive inference and training deployments that may demand 30-50 kW or more. Investors evaluating data center assets or development sites need to account for whether the underlying electrical and cooling infrastructure can support that density evolution.
Data sovereignty regulation is tightening across Latin America, following patterns established by GDPR in Europe. As local data residency requirements become more prescriptive, the demand case for in-country data center capacity strengthens — a tailwind that benefits all three markets discussed here.
Edge computing deployment, driven by the expansion of 5G networks and latency-sensitive applications, will also require distributed infrastructure across tier-2 and tier-3 cities. That creates investment opportunity beyond the Santiago-Bogotá-Lima corridor, but it also requires a different operational model than centralized hyperscale campuses.
The Strategic Posture That Makes Sense Right Now
The data center expansion story in South America is real, it's fundable, and it's moving fast enough that the window for advantaged entry is narrowing — particularly in Chile, where asset prices are already reflecting institutional interest.
Peru and Colombia offer longer runways but demand more sophisticated market entry strategies: local partnerships, patient capital structures, and genuine expertise in navigating regulatory environments that don't always operate on predictable timelines.
For infrastructure investors with a 7-to-10-year horizon, the regional thesis is compelling. Cloud services demand doesn't reverse. Data sovereignty pressure doesn't ease. And the hyperscalers building cloud regions in Santiago, Bogotá, and eventually Lima aren't making those commitments tentatively — they're building permanent anchors around which the broader ecosystem will grow.
The question isn't whether South America becomes a meaningful data center investment region. It already is. The question is which specific markets, power infrastructure positions, and connectivity assets get acquired before that becomes the consensus view.
